Originally Posted by lowblue320
I have 300 promax not X's....I had 15 1/2 x 35 and lost a prop and ordered 15x32's the boat had really hard acceleration but was banging on the limiters, so we sent the back and got 15x34, boat has better attitude and midrange but still bangs the limiters whem trimmed out....deff. better top end with the 15 1/2 x 35 Mercury Cleavers..
hull is a 98 and motors are 2003's with props spinning out.
